The phrase "alternating themes"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e a situation where different themes are presented in a back-and-forth manner, often in literature, art, or discussions.
Example: "The novel is captivating due to its alternating themes of love and loss, which keep the reader engaged throughout."
Alternatives: "shifting themes" or "fluctuating themes".
